[ARCHIVED] Shop Local on Tax-Free Weekend and Beyond

shop local

Support your favorite Wellesley merchants by shopping locally during sales tax-free weekend and throughout the fall. 

The State’s annual sales tax-free weekend is planned for Saturday, August 29 through Sunday, August 30. The event supports both consumers and businesses. This year shoppers are especially encouraged to support small, local businesses impacted by the ongoing Coronavirus pandemic. 

Many businesses in Wellesley continue to face challenges and keep working very hard to find creative ways to attract and serve their customers. 

In addition to tax-free weekend, the Commonwealth has launched "My Local MA," a campaign showcasing the variety of businesses and attractions that are a critical part of our State and local economies. 

The campaign runs through December 2020 and includes information and resources for shoppers, as well as a dedicated website FindMyLocalMA.com

A reminder to all shoppers to continue to adhere to current Coronavirus requirements and safety practices including "masking up" when shopping and practicing social distancing to keep all employees and consumers safe.
